                Lovely shots - pin sharp! Sorry to sound pedantic but as Cathedrals were built on an East-West axis (ish), you're north is east, and your west is south. Cathedrals are also great to photograph in the early evening, of course, though without a tripod you have to be inventive with shutter speeds! Incidentally, on the more sober subject, a friend of a friend was helping to dismantle the organ in Christchurch Methodist chuch when the earthquake struck. He was saved becaause the soundboard of the organ fell on him, and he was wearing a hard hat. His two colleagues weren't so lucky, and were both killed. Sobering indeed.
